Just as Long as I Have You

Summary

"Just as Long as I Have You" is a song written by Dave Loggins and J.D. Martin. Loggins originally recorded the song with Gus Hardin in 1985. Their version peaked at number 72 on the Billboard Hot Country Singles chart.

The song was later covered by American country music artist Don Williams. It was released in January 1990 as the third single from Williams' album One Good Well. His version reached number 4 on the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ks chart.[1]
